As opposed to keys from the past and the present, modern Audi keys have an electronic chip that can activate your engine as well as other features. This means you can't simply purchase a replacement key from a dealer, however, you must have the key programmed to your specific vehicle. Audi dealers have special tools to program your key fob remotes however, they could charge an additional cost for this service. Modern Audi keys contain a microchip that must be programmed into the car to allow it to start. This is done by a dealer, who is only able to do this if you have proof of ownership. Alternatively, you can call an auto locksmith to reprogram your car key however, they might not be able to do this for every vehicle model.
